How To Fix CUSTOMER_DOWNTIME007 - Customer downtime ended


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CUSTOMER_DOWNTIME - Customer initiated Downtime

  • Message number: 007

  • Message text: Customer downtime ended

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CUSTOMER_DOWNTIME007 - Customer downtime ended ?

    The SAP error message CUSTOMER_DOWNTIME007 indicates that a customer downtime period has ended. This message is typically related to the maintenance or upgrade activities in an SAP system, where a downtime window is scheduled for performing necessary tasks that require the system to be unavailable to users.

    Cause:

    1. Scheduled Downtime: The message is generated when the scheduled downtime period for maintenance or upgrades has concluded.
    2. System Configuration: It may also occur if the system is configured to automatically notify users or log events when the downtime period ends.
    3. User Actions: It can be triggered by user actions that signal the end of a maintenance window.

    Solution:

    1. Verify System Status: Check the system status to ensure that all maintenance activities have been completed successfully and that the system is back online.
    2. Notify Users: Inform users that the system is available for use again after the downtime.
    3. Review Logs: Look at the system logs to ensure there were no issues during the downtime period that could affect system performance.
    4. Post-Downtime Checks: Conduct any necessary post-downtime checks to confirm that all functionalities are working as expected.
